Transaction e959823a75d87de94068fc2dcefe31e101ea9ab776420160a30a2f42ab40f6c8
1 Input
1 Output
-
e959823a75d87de94068fc2dcefe31e101ea9ab776420160a30a2f42ab40f6c8:0
- value
- 1959915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7270c2047450d286ff37c30b08da504a57beeb6f OP_EQUAL
- address
- 3C882y4GaS4PAGsx69n5kwvic5UHSXKSJq